This is complicated by growing measures of regulation from countries around the world. Australia passed landmark legislation in 2024 barring minors under 16 from having accounts on social media platforms like Facebook, TikTok, and YouTube. Domestically, 32 states have introduced age verification legislation, and that is only intensified in externalities that are yet to be seen after the Federal Trade Commission announced last week it would exercise “enforcement discretion” regarding the Children’s Online Privacy Protection Rule (COPPA). This would allow social media companies to collect children’s data without parental consent—but solely for age verification purposes.
